Playing styles and prediction

After a poor start to the year, Kotov has found his feet on the clay after reaching the semi-finals of Marrakech a couple of weeks ago. Now the qualifier will look to climb inside the world’s top 100 as he looks to continue his consistent statistics on clay.

Norrie will need to return well against the effective serving of Kotov with the qualifier maximising his serving strength so far this season. This will be a tough match for Norrie which will see the Brit needing to find the right balance between being aggressive but also not producing too many erratic unforced errors. If Norrie can dominate play on return then he should win in straight sets as he looks to build momentum ahead of Madrid.

Prediction: Norrie in straight sets.
